Key findings
Tribunal's reasoningThe judgment was given by consent of the parties. It determined that the respondent was ordered to pay the claimant £748.41 gross in respect of pay for accrued but untaken annual leave.
No contested findings of fact, legal tests, or separate remedy components were recorded in the judgment. The judgment did not address any discrimination claim or protected characteristic.
